Srinivasa Rao Chintalapudi Talks About Bad Boy Kartik in Exclusive Interview

Srinivasa Rao Chintalapudi Talks About Bad Boy Kartik in Exclusive Interview

How was your journey as a producer?
Srinivasa Rao Chintalapudi: I was a partner in the film Shashi with Aadi Sai Kumar. Bad Boy Kartik is our first film as producers, and we are very excited for its release. The movie has turned out really well.

What can the audience expect from Bad Boy Kartik?
Srinivasa Rao Chintalapudi: The movie is an out-and-out action commercial entertainer. Shourya has always been seen in lover boy roles, but in this film, you’ll see him in a completely action-packed role. We’ve worked with top-notch technicians like Supreme Sundar and Prithvi for action choreography. Harish Jayaraj has given an amazing album. The choreography by Shobi Master and Raju Sundaram is fantastic, and we have a strong cast including Samuthirakani, Naresh, Sai Kumar, Vennela Kishore, and Sridevi Vijay Kumar in pivotal roles.

Tell us about Sridevi Vijay Kumar’s role in the film?
Srinivasa Rao Chintalapudi:Sridevi Vijay Kumar’s character will be one of the highlights of the film. Her role will definitely surprise everyone. After this film, she will be very busy.

Can you talk about Zee Studios’ involvement?
Srinivasa Rao Chintalapudi:Zee Studios will be distributing the film worldwide, and they’ve shown a lot of confidence in the project. They’re also handling the OTT release. The film will be released on over 400 screens, making it a grand release.
